#!/bin/bash
# rankmirrors-arm : rank archlinuxarm mirrors using rankmirrors utility

declare -r myname='rankmirrors-arm'
declare -r myver='1.0'
pacmirrorlist=${PACMIRRORLIST:-/et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ist}
declare -i USE_PACMAN=0 USE_GET=0 USE_FILE=0 OUTPUTONLY=0
usage() {
cat <<EOF
${myname} v${myver}
Rank archlinuxarm mirrors using rankmirrors utility.
Usage: $myname [-p | -g | -f MIRRORLIST] [-n | -m] [-o]
General Options:
-o/--output do not overwrite pacman mirrorlist, only show generated mirrorlist
Source Options: select one (default: --pacman)
-p/--pacman use the current pacman mirrorlist
-g/--get get the current mirrorlist from archlinuxarm's pacman-mirrorlist sources
-f/--file use the specified MIRRORFILE
--pacman Options:
-u/--update Only in combination with -p. For use in upgrade hook. Tries to use mirrorlist.pacnew instead of old mirrorlist
Rankmirrors Options: passed on to rankmirrors tool
-n NUM number of servers to output, 0 for all
-m/--max-time NUM specify a ranking operation timeout, can be decimal number
Environment Variables:
PACMIRRORLIST override pacman mirrorlist path (default: /et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ist)
Example: $myname --pacman -n 6 --output
Example: PACMIRRORLIST="/etc/pacman.d/local_mirrorlist" $myname
EOF
}
version() {
printf "%s %s\n" "$myname" "$myver"
echo 'Copyright (C) 2018 Martin Födinger <martin@foedinger.ml>'
echo
echo "This is free software; see the source for copying conditions."
echo "There is NO WARRANTY, to the extent permitted by law."
}
msg() {
(( QUIET )) && return
local mesg=$1; shift
printf "${GREEN}==>${ALL_OFF}${BOLD} ${mesg}${ALL_OFF}\n" "$@" >&1
}
error() {
local mesg=$1; shift
printf "${RED}==> $(gettext "ERROR:")${ALL_OFF}${BOLD} ${mesg}${ALL_OFF}\n" "$@" >&2
}
strip_content() {
(( OUTPUTONLY )) || msg "Stripping unneeded content from mirrorlist"
#delete blank lines, uncomment all Servers, remove every line not starting with Server =
sed '/^\s*$/d; s/^# Server/Server/; /^Server = /!d' $1 > /tmp/mirrorlist.tmp
}
# prefer terminal safe colored and bold text when tput is supported
if tput setaf 0 &>/dev/null; then
ALL_OFF="$(tput sgr0)"
BOLD="$(tput bold)"
BLUE="${BOLD}$(tput setaf 4)"
GREEN="${BOLD}$(tput setaf 2)"
RED="${BOLD}$(tput setaf 1)"
YELLOW="${BOLD}$(tput setaf 3)"
else
ALL_OFF="\e[1;0m"
BOLD="\e[1;1m"
BLUE="${BOLD}\e[1;34m"
GREEN="${BOLD}\e[1;32m"
RED="${BOLD}\e[1;31m"
YELLOW="${BOLD}\e[1;33m"
fi
readonly ALL_OFF BOLD BLUE GREEN RED YELLOW
#argument passing
while [[ -n "$1" ]]; do
case "$1" in
-p|--pacman)
USE_PACMAN=1;;
-u|--update)
USE_UPDATE=1;;
-g|--get)
USE_GET=1;;
-f|--file)
USE_FILE=1;
[[ $2 ]] || error "Must specify Mirrorlist when using -f/--file";
MIRRORFILE="$2"; shift;;
-o|--output)
OUTPUTONLY=1;;
-n)
RM_MAXSERVERS="-n $2"; shift;;
-m|--max-time)
RM_MAXTIME="-m $2"; shift;;
-V|--version)
version; exit 0;;
-h|--help)
usage; exit 0;;
*)
usage; exit 1;;
esac
shift
done
case $(( USE_PACMAN + USE_GET + USE_FILE )) in
0) USE_PACMAN=1;; #set default source option
[^1]) error "Only one source option may be used at a time."
usage; exit 1;;
esac
case $(( USE_PACMAN + USE_UPDATE )) in
2) pacmirrorlist='/etc/pacman.d/mirrorlist.pacnew';;
esac
(( OUTPUTONLY )) || msg "Retrieving source mirrorlist"
#write mirrors to /tmp/mirrorlist.tmp using strip_content
if (( USE_PACMAN )); then
strip_content $pacmirrorlist
elif (( USE_GET )); then
if wget https://raw.githubusercontent.com/archlinuxarm/PKGBUILDs/master/core/pacman-mirrorlist/mirrorlist -O /tmp/mirrorlist.inet.tmp; then
strip_content /tmp/mirrorlist.inet.tmp
else
error "wget command failed!"
fi
elif (( USE_FILE )); then
strip_content $MIRRORFILE
fi
if (( OUTPUTONLY )); then
rankmirrors $RM_MAXSERVERS $RM_MAXTIME /tmp/mirrorlist.tmp
else
pacmirrorlist=${pacmirrorlist%%.pacnew}
cp $pacmirrorlist $pacmirrorlist.bckp
rankmirrors $RM_MAXSERVERS $RM_MAXTIME /tmp/mirrorlist.tmp > $pacmirrorlist
msg "Replaced Pacman's mirrorlist with new one!"
fi
